Susan works as a chef(厨师) in a large hotel. One
day after finishing her scheduled work, she went into the
cold storage room to check on some ingredients needed for
the next day. Unfortunately, the door closed behind her,
locking her inside.
She was in a panic, screaming and banging on the
door with all strength, but no one could hear her cries.
Most of the staff ( 员 工) had already left. And from
outside, it was impossible to hear the sounds coming from
the sealed(密封的) room. Three hours later, when she
was on the brink of passing out, the hotel security guard
( 保 安 ) finally opened the door. That day, she
fortunately escaped death.
Later, she asked the security guard how he came to
open the door as it was not part of his duties. The guard
explained, “ Ive been working at this hotel for 20 years
and hundreds of staff come in and out every day. Many
people treat me like Im invisible, but youre one of the
few who greet me in the morning and say goodbye to me at
night. Today when you reported for work, you greeted me
as usual with a ‘hi’, but this evening, I didnt hear your
usual ‘ goodbye’ . Thats when I sensed something was
wrong and decided to check around. I always look forward
to your ‘hi’ and ‘goodbye’ because they remind me that
Im not invisible but an important person. ”

Many scientists believe that our love of sugar may
actually be an addiction(上瘾) . When we eat or drink
sugary foods, the sugar enters our blood and affects the
parts of our brain that make us feel good. Then the good
feeling goes away, leaving us wanting more. All tasty
foods do this, but sugar has a particularly strong effect. In
this way, it is in fact an addictive drug(毒品), one that
doctors recommend(推荐) we all cut down on.
“ It seems like every time I study an illness and trace
(追踪) a path to the first cause, I find my way back to
sugar,” says scientist Richard Johnson. One-third of
adults worldwide have high blood pressure, and up to 347
million have diabetes(糖 尿 病 ) . Why? “ Sugar, we
believe, is one of the culprits, if not the major culprit,”
says Johnson.
Our bodies are designed to survive on very little
sugar. Early humans often had very little food, so our
bodies learned to be very efficient(有效的) in storing sugar
as fat. In this way, we had energy stored for when there was
no food. But today, most people have more than enough. So
the very thing that once saved us may be killing us.
So what is the solution? Its obvious that we need to
eat less sugar. The trouble is, in todays world, its
extremely difficult to avoid. From breakfast cereals (谷
物) to after-dinner desserts, our foods are increasingly
filled with it. Some producers even use sugar to replace
taste in foods that are said as low in fat. So while the foods
appear to be healthier, large amounts of sugar are often
added.
But some people are fighting back against sugar and
trying to create a healthier environment. Many schools are
replacing sugary desserts with healthier options, like fruit.
44
Other schools are trying to encourage exercise by building
facilities(设施) like tracks so students and others in the
community can exercise. The battle has not yet been lost.
